Transaction 768c09fa2ebe990f776a5258c9917207c9382479098dc70f1c97b7f914344e7e
1 Input
1 Output
-
768c09fa2ebe990f776a5258c9917207c9382479098dc70f1c97b7f914344e7e:0
- value
- 18897282
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 3062ad170149c853fc1a814958b2049442a40f6a OP_EQUAL
- address
- 366rZtYU3io88jrbc1xn4waq5Q8gFo4EHV